Operant Conditioning
A process of learning in which the dynamics of behavior are adjusted by assigning incentives or penalties.
Extinction
In psychology, the gradual weakening and disappearance of a conditioned response tendency.
Variable-Ratio
A reinforcement schedule in which a response is rewarded after an unpredictable number of responses, commonly used in operant conditioning.
Fixed-Interval
A schedule of reinforcement where the first response is rewarded only after a specified amount of time has elapsed.
